ABSTRACT
Background/Aims@#Carbon dioxide is increasingly used in insufflation during colonoscopy in adult patients; however, air insufflation remains the primary practice among pediatric gastroenterologists. This systematic review and meta-analysis aims to evaluate insufflation using CO2 versus air in colonoscopies in pediatric patients. @*Methods@#Individualized search strategies were performed using MEDLINE, Cochrane Library, EMBASE, and LILACS databases following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ines and Cochrane working methodology. Randomized control trials (RCTs) were selected for the present meta-analysis. Pooled proportions were calculated for outcomes including procedure time and abdominal pain immediately and 24 hours post-procedure. @*Results@#The initial search yielded 644 records, of which five RCTs with a total of 358 patients (CO2 n=178 versus air n=180) were included in the final analysis. The procedure time was not different between the CO2 and air insufflation groups (mean difference, 10.84; 95% confidence interval [CI], -2.55 to 24.22; p=0.11). Abdominal pain immediately post-procedure was significantly lower in the CO2 group (risk difference, -0.15; 95% CI; -0.26 to -0.03; p=0.01) while abdominal pain at 24 hours post-procedure was similar (risk difference, -0.05; 95% CI; -0.11 to 0.01; p=0.11). @*Conclusions@#Based on this systematic review and meta-analysis of RCT data, CO2 insufflation reduced abdominal pain immediately following the procedure, while pain was similar at 24 hours post-procedure. These results suggest that CO2 is a preferred insufflation technique when performing colonoscopy in pediatric patients.
